Interim Director of SEND and Disabilities
£700 - £800 per day (INSIDE IR35)
6 Month Contract
Maidstone

Our client has got an exciting new opportunity for an Interim Director of SEND and Disabilities. This is a contract role for 6 months and you will be required to have experience working at a Director level in SEND to be considered for this role. As well as this, you must also have:

• Extensive experience and successful track record of strategic leadership and successful delivery in local government and/or other relevant large and complex organisations working within the children’s services arena.

• Experience of SEND and (preferably) disabled children services at a senior level. Experience of the interface between the local authority statutory function (code of practice) and schools for vulnerable pupils and those with special educational needs.

• Extensive experience of working with schools, school-based organisations, related partners and regulatory/support bodies such as Ofsted and the Regional Schools Commissioner (RSC)

• Experience of effectively managing and delivering a range of key integrated services and change programmes for children and families within a designated budget

• Extensive experience and successful track record of achieving improvements in service delivery and improved outcomes for children and young people.

• Extensive experience and track record in delivering a range of services in partnership with other agencies and stakeholders, both internal and external.

• Experience of Planning and performance monitoring across agencies

• Experience of commissioning and decommissioning of services

• Extensive experience of working and influencing the direction of services within a highly political environment.

Responsibilities of the role:

• To lead the delivery and strategic development of services to disabled children and young people and those with Special Educational Needs ensuring those services (in-house and commissioned) meet the needs of all those children, are aligned to information on need and that they continue to meet the changing needs of children and young people.

• To contribute as a member of the Directorate Management Team to the strategic leadership of the Directorate.

• To champion the needs of children with additional needs ensuring an inclusive high quality service that works in partnership with families to maximise children's potential.

• Lead the operational delivery and strategic development of all services to disabled children and young people (0 to 25 years) and those with SEND, ensuring that services match needs, are developed in partnership with parents and young people.

• To take a key role in the inclusion agenda, liaising with other Directors and where appropriate, schools to ensure that services are inclusive and supportive of children achieving their potential.

• Lead the delivery of high-quality services to disabled children that safeguard their needs in line with national standards, policies and procedures.

• Lead the development of services, ensuring that they are client centred, high quality and fit for purpose, driving the earlier identification of emerging need and be responsible for putting into place a range of services that prevent those needs escalating as young people grow older and working with families to provide tailored support which allows them to stay together.

• Ensure that SEND assessments are of the highest quality and that they result in the appropriate educational provision for children.
